ISO language codes are designed to represent most of the languages in the world. Slovak and Abkhaz ISO language codes consists of ISO 639 1, ISO 639 2, ISO 639 3 codes. ISO 639 1 is the two letter code, while ISO 639 2 and ISO 639 3 are three letter codes.

The language codes are mainly used in the computer and information systems. The ISO codes are set of international standards that are short unique representation for language names.
